Unimplemented error when the output table contains timestamp with timezone #787

Description

When we create a table with the following schema (the ts column is a timestamp with a time zone):

Then we query this table, its output will report unimplemented error:

But if we change the flight sql jdbc driver from 18.3.0 to 18.2.0 or earlier, the ouput is just fine.

Plantform

  • Client: DBeaver Community Edition 25.1.0
  • Operating System: Windows 10 19045.5965
  • Database: datalayers (our proprietary database)
  • Driver: flight-sql-jdbc-driver 18.3.0

Potential reasons

The error messages suggest the issue stems from Arrow-Java 18.3.0 is dependent on Calcite-Avatica 1.26.0. It appears Calcite-Avatica 1.26.0 doesn't support timestamp types with timezone in query result sets. In contrast, Arrow-Java 18.2.0 and earlier versions rely on Calcite-Avatica 1.25.0 (as seen in #634), which explains why their query result sets are correct.
